On 30 November in Vyshhorod, the Kyiv region, rescuers from the State Emergency Service of Ukraine (SESU) neutralized Russian cluster munitions carried by a Shahed drone.
According to the SESU, the drone struck the roof of an apartment building but did not detonate.
On the roof, responders found the drone’s warhead and 21 cluster submunitions equipped with self-destruct mechanisms. Another submunition was discovered in the building’s courtyard.
A cluster munition consists of a tubular element containing explosive fragments that were likely intended to detonate together with the main warhead in order to complicate clearance by specialized services and cause additional civilian casualties.
To avoid any risk to people, the area around the building was cordoned off, and the residents of the upper floors were evacuated.
Drones and a specialized robot were brought in for the operation. The robot collected the dangerous items into a special container, which was then loaded into a pyrotechnic vehicle using a crane.
All the recovered cluster elements and the drone’s warhead were neutralized with a controlled explosion at a designated site.
